            <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Here’s a structured <strong>Skills Pyramid for a Tableau Developer</strong> that organizes skills from foundational to advanced/expert levels. I’ll break it down layer by layer, like a pyramid, showing progression:</p><figure><img alt="" src="https://cdn-images-1.medium.com/max/1024/1*WS-wore6O4cI8b3Y9dkBuQ.png" /></figure><h3>1. Foundation (Base Layer) — Essential Skills</h3><p>These are the core skills every Tableau Developer must have:</p><p><strong>Data Fundamentals</strong>:</p><ul><li>Understanding data types, structures, and relational databases</li><li>Basic SQL queries for data extraction</li></ul><p><strong>Excel &amp; Spreadsheet Knowledge</strong>:</p><ul><li>Formulas, pivot tables, and data manipulation</li></ul><p><strong>Tableau Desktop Basics</strong>:</p><ul><li>Connecting to data sources</li><li>Basic charts (bar, line, pie, scatter, maps)</li><li>Sorting, filtering, grouping</li></ul><h3>2. Intermediate Layer — Analytical &amp; Visualization Skills</h3><p>Skills for producing insightful dashboards and performing intermediate analytics:</p><p><strong>Data Preparation &amp; Cleaning</strong>:</p><ul><li>Using Tableau Prep or in-Tableau data preparation</li><li>Joining, blending, and aggregating data</li></ul><p><strong>Intermediate Tableau Skills</strong>:</p><ul><li>Calculated fields (string, numeric, logical, date)</li><li>Table calculations</li><li>Parameters and sets</li><li>Hierarchies and drill-down functionality</li></ul><p><strong>Visualization Best Practices</strong>:</p><ul><li>Dashboard design principles</li><li>Storytelling with data</li><li>Color theory and UX for dashboards</li></ul><h3>3. Advanced Layer — Expert Analytical &amp; Integration Skills</h3><p>Skills to handle complex requirements and integrate Tableau in enterprise environments:</p><p><strong>Advanced Tableau Techniques</strong>:</p><ul><li>LOD (Level of Detail) calculations</li><li>Advanced table calculations and nested calculations</li><li>Dynamic dashboards with actions</li></ul><p><strong>Data Modeling &amp; Optimization</strong>:</p><ul><li>Star/snowflake schemas</li><li>Performance tuning and query optimization</li></ul><p><strong>Integration &amp; Automation</strong>:</p><ul><li>Tableau Server/Online: publishing, permissions, scheduling extracts</li><li>APIs (REST API, Tableau JavaScript API)</li><li>Automation of reports and alerts</li></ul><h3>4. Leadership / Strategic Layer — Expert &amp; Strategic Skills</h3><p>Top-tier skills for senior developers or BI leads:</p><p><strong>Business Acumen</strong>:</p><ul><li>Translating business requirements into actionable insights</li><li>KPI definition and metrics standardization</li></ul><p><strong>Project Management</strong>:</p><ul><li>Agile methodology for BI projects</li><li>Stakeholder management</li></ul><p><strong>Mentorship &amp; Governance</strong>:</p><ul><li>Establishing Tableau governance, standards, and best practices</li><li>Mentoring junior developers and training users</li></ul><h4>Optional Skills / Emerging Skills</h4><ul><li>Integration with Python/R for advanced analytics</li><li>Cloud data platforms (Snowflake, BigQuery, Redshift)</li><li>Predictive analytics &amp; AI integration</li><li>Advanced dashboard interactivity (extensions, embedded analytics)</li></ul><p>#Tableau #DataVisualization #BusinessIntelligence #TableauDeveloper #DataAnalytics #DashboardDesign #DataScience #SQL #DataPrep #TableauTips #Analytics #DataDriven #TableauServer #DataStorytelling #TableauCommunity #AdvancedAnalytics #PythonForData #BigData #CloudAnalytics #TableauSkills #CareerInData #DataGovernance #TableauTraining #AnalyticsLeadership</p><img src="https://medium.com/_/stat?event=post.clientViewed&referrerSource=full_rss&postId=8572499d2ec7" width="1" height="1" alt="">]]></content:encoded>

            <content:encoded><![CDATA[<ul><li><strong>Chart:</strong> Information presented in a tabular, graphical form with data displayed along two axes. Can be in the form of a graph, diagram, or map.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/data-insights/reference-library/visual-analytics/charts">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Table:</strong> A set of figures displayed in rows and columns.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/data-insights/reference-library/visual-analytics/tables">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Graph:</strong> A diagram of points, lines, segments, curves, or areas that represents certain variables in comparison to each other, usually along two axes at a right angle.</li><li><strong>Geospatial:</strong> A visualization that shows data in map form using different shapes and colors to show the relationship between pieces of data and specific locations.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/data-insights/reference-library/visual-analytics/geospatial">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Infographic: </strong>A combination of visuals and words that represent data. Usually uses charts or diagrams.</li><li><strong>Dashboards: </strong>A collection of visualizations and data displayed in one place to help with analyzing and presenting data.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/learn/webinars/what-dashboard-anyway">Learn more.</a></li></ul><p>— — -</p><ul><li><strong>Area Map:</strong> A form of geospatial visualization, area maps are used to show specific values set over a map of a country, state, county, or any other geographic location. Two common types of area maps are choropleths and isopleths.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/data-insights/reference-library/visual-analytics/geospatial/area-maps">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Bar Chart:</strong> Bar charts represent numerical values compared to each other. The length of the bar represents the value of each variable.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/data-insights/reference-library/visual-analytics/charts/bar-charts">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Box-and-whisker Plots:</strong> These show a selection of ranges (the box) across a set measure (the bar). <a href="https://www.tableau.com/data-insights/reference-library/visual-analytics/charts/box-whisker">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Bullet Graph: </strong>A bar marked against a background to show progress or performance against a goal, denoted by a line on the graph.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/data-insights/reference-library/visual-analytics/charts/bullet-graphs">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Gantt Chart:</strong> Typically used in project management, Gantt charts are a bar chart depiction of timelines and tasks.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/learn/articles/how-to/gantt-chart">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Heat Map: </strong>A type of geospatial visualization in map form which displays specific data values as different colors (this doesn’t need to be temperatures, but that is a common use). <a href="https://www.tableau.com/data-insights/reference-library/visual-analytics/tables/highlight-tables-and-heatmaps">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Highlight Table:</strong> A form of table that uses color to categorize similar data, allowing the viewer to read it more easily and intuitively.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/data-insights/reference-library/visual-analytics/tables/highlight-tables-and-heatmaps">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Histogram: </strong>A type of bar chart that split a continuous measure into different bins to help analyze the distribution.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/learn/articles/how-to/histogram">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Pie Chart:</strong> A circular chart with triangular segments that shows data as a percentage of a whole.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/data-insights/reference-library/visual-analytics/charts/pie-charts">Learn more.</a></li><li><strong>Treemap: </strong>A type of chart that shows different, related values in the form of rectangles nested together. <a href="https://www.tableau.com/data-insights/reference-library/visual-analytics/charts/treemaps">Learn more.</a></li></ul><img src="https://medium.com/_/stat?event=post.clientViewed&referrerSource=full_rss&postId=e4599cdf1d81" width="1" height="1" alt="">]]></content:encoded>

            <content:encoded><![CDATA[<h3><strong>What is a row-level record? — Day 6</strong></h3><p><strong>What is a row-level record in Tableau ?</strong></p><p>In Tableau, a row-level record refers to each individual data entry or observation in your dataset. It represents a single data point containing values for each field or column in your data source.</p><figure><img alt="" src="https://cdn-images-1.medium.com/max/548/1*dS8f-rf6Gw4uZNj8I7fEpw.png" /><figcaption>Each row in this dataset represents a row-level record. For instance, the first row indicates that Alice, with Student ID 1, scored an “A” grade in Math. Similarly, the second row shows that Bob, with Student ID 2, scored a “B” grade in Science, and so on.</figcaption></figure><p>In Tableau, you would typically visualize data based on these row-level records, aggregating or summarizing them as needed for your analysis.</p><p>Sure, let’s consider a real-life example using sales data from an online retail store:</p><figure><img alt="" src="https://cdn-images-1.medium.com/max/549/1*FKAg53VI__TfWWyt4aeosw.png" /><figcaption>In this dataset:</figcaption></figure><ul><li>Each row represents a single transaction or sale made by a customer.</li><li>The columns represent various attributes of the transaction, such as Order ID, Customer Name, Product purchased, Quantity bought, Price per unit, and Total amount spent.</li></ul><p>So, each row-level record corresponds to a specific purchase made by a customer. For example:</p><ul><li>Row 1 shows that Alice bought a Laptop, with an order ID of 1001, Quantity of 1, Price of $800, and Total amount spent of $800.</li><li>Row 2 shows that Bob purchased 2 Smartphones, with an order ID of 1002, Quantity of 2, Price of $400 each, and Total amount spent of $800.</li><li>Row 3 indicates that Charlie bought a Tablet, with an order ID of 1003, Quantity of 1, Price of $300, and Total amount spent of $300.</li></ul><p>In Tableau, you would work with these row-level records to create visualizations, such as sales trends over time, top-selling products, or customer segmentation based on purchasing behavior.</p><p><a href="https://medium.com/u/fcbe60d0bf8b">Tableau Conference</a> #Tableau #DataFam #DataViz #LearnTableau #FreeSourceTableau</p><img src="https://medium.com/_/stat?event=post.clientViewed&referrerSource=full_rss&postId=1601fb91e43d" width="1" height="1" alt="">]]></content:encoded>
